Disinfectants: How to Make the Best Choices for Your Clinical Practice

Disinfectants are chemicals designed to kill microorganisms residing on non-living surfaces. These products must be registered with the Environmental Protection Agency (EPA) and are required to display the designated EPA-Registration Number on the product label. The main ingredient found in EPA-registered, hospital grade disinfectants used throughout the hearing industry range from a form of alcohol, quaternary ammonium compound (“quat”), hydrogen peroxide, citric acid, or a combination formula of alcohol/hydrogen peroxide or quat/alcohol mix. With so many products available, here are things to know when choosing disinfectants for your clinical practice:

USE EPA-REGISTERED, HOSPITAL GRADE PRODUCTS

While household products kill germs, EPA-registered, hospital grade disinfectants kill a broad spectrum of microorganisms commonly found in hospitals and other facilities providing patient care and/or provision of allied health services. USE ALCOHOL-FREE DISINFECTANTS WHEN RECOMMENDED

Alcohol chemically denatures acrylic, rubber, plastic and silicone. Since most audiology components are composed of these materials, many manufacturers recommend using alcohol-free chemicals to disinfect smaller components and items like hearing instruments, earmolds, remote microphone systems, and headphone cushions. DWELL TIME

The EPA registers the specific microorganisms a disinfectant kills and the corresponding amount of time it takes to kill those specific microorganisms. The product must stay wet on a surface for the required amount of time in order to be effective. Referred to as dwell time (or kill time), most EPA-registered, hospital grade disinfectants require 30-seconds to 3 minutes to effectively kill microorganisms although some products require 10 minutes to effectively kill certain microorganisms. It is important to read and follow product instructions.

Final Thoughts:

  • For larger touch and splash surfaces (e.g. countertops, table surfaces, door handles, etc), use any available EPA-registered, hospital grade disinfectant in any form (e.g. spray, wipes)
  • For equipment and related components comprised of acrylic, rubber, plastic or silicone parts, use an alcohol-free, EPA-registered, hospital grade disinfectant in any form.
